#b816e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b816e2 is composed of 72.2% red, 8.6%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.6%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 287.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 48.6%. #b816e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cff with #7100c5.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#b816e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09010b is the darkest color, while #fdf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b816e2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807583 is the less saturated color, while #c303f5 is the most saturated one.
